I have a 3.8m Zodiac with a 35 Evenrude.
I launched for the first time this week from a very shallow shelving beach N.Wales. The trailer is a bit of a heavy when you have to got far out to float off. Will transom fitted launching wheels be the answer? i.e. dump it of the trailer at the water line? Garry |

Gary, I made a trailer tongue extension for mine. Basically a six foot piece of
tubing with a coupler on the end, then machined some brackets that bolt to the side of the tongue. Got the idea? |
